Julio's Shop

Julio's Shop

Car Audio - Video Systems in Los Angeles, CA

Car Audio - Video Systems

Contact us

Location

4714 E Olympic Blvd.,
Los Angeles , CA 90022 UNITED STATES

Reviews

Julio's Shop 323-262-5797
4714 E Olympic Blvd.,
Los Angeles , CA 90022 UNITED STATES
$
Julio's Shop

Detail information

Company name
Julio's Shop
Category
Car Audio - Video Systems
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

Julio's Shop

Contacts Location Details